Mother’s Day is a special occasion to honor and appreciate all mothers, regardless of their circumstances. Whether you’re a biological mother, a fur mom, a single mom, a working mom, or a foster mom, you deserve to be celebrated. Here are 10 tips to make this Mother’s Day truly memorable:
For All Moms:
- Self-Care Day:
- Pamper yourself: Take a long, hot bath, read a book, or meditate.
- Indulge in your favorite hobbies: Paint, garden, or simply relax.
- Quality Time with Loved Ones:
- Spend quality time with your family and friends.
- Have a family dinner, go on a picnic, or simply enjoy each other’s company.
- Acts of Service:
- Let your loved ones do the chores for the day.
- Enjoy a day off from cooking, cleaning, or other household tasks.
For Fur Moms:
- Pamper Your Fur Baby:
- Take your pet to the groomer or give them a spa day at home.
- Buy them a new toy or treat.
- Nature Walks:
- Enjoy a leisurely walk in a park or nature reserve with your furry friend.
For Single Moms:
- Me Time:
- Schedule some “me time” to recharge.
- Go out for a movie, dinner, or shopping.
- Community Support:
- Connect with other single moms in your community.
- Join a support group or online forum.
For Working Moms:
- Work-Life Balance:
- Take a break from work and spend time with your family.
- Disconnect from work emails and calls.
- Mindful Parenting:
- Practice mindful parenting techniques to reduce stress and enhance your bond with your children.
- Engage in activities that promote mindfulness, such as yoga or meditation.
For Foster Moms:
- Self-Compassion:
- Practice self-compassion and acknowledge the challenges of fostering.
- Celebrate your achievements and resilience.
Mother’s Day is a day to celebrate your unique journey as a mother. No matter your circumstances, take the time to appreciate yourself and all that you do.
